                    • Originally posted by Guiness View Post
                      I need to watch again at the down, distance and time remaining. Which catch by Finley are you guys referring to? For some reason I remember wanting him to get out of bounds???
                      End of game, last drive. About 1:50 or so left on clock. 3rd and 3, he caught a crossing pattern and ran for 40 yards or so. Had a first immediately after the catch. After 30 yards had a decent FG. Then defender closed and he fought for more yardage with a stiff arm and was angled OOB. Stopped clock.

                      At this point, the odds favored the Pack in a huge way: http://live.advancednflstats.com/ind...id1=2013101300

                      But the Ravens still had a TO or two. On the third down play, before Lacy got a first, there was 1:32 left. Had Fin not gone OOB, the clock would have been running and the Ravens would not be able to get the ball back even if they stuffed the Packers on 3rd down with more than 30 seconds on the clock.
